Transaction 70da0bc316ef20086c45b1cf52623bc4ec03b3641e9a03ebd09ca16763e75079
2 Input
2 Outputs
- 70da0bc316ef20086c45b1cf52623bc4ec03b3641e9a03ebd09ca16763e75079:0
- 70da0bc316ef20086c45b1cf52623bc4ec03b3641e9a03ebd09ca16763e75079:1
value 40000
address 2N4vGCEsao4E7XieV3dTo2TdURGKcqUhvbA
value 67413
address mpvcMVLaY8rUw1qEdmryYqimsYPZWqTfkh